Our client is seeking an experienced and motivated Litigation Solicitor to join their growing team. This is an excellent opportunity for a qualified solicitor looking to develop their career within a well-established and supportive firm, handling a broad range of contentious matters. The successful candidate will manage their own caseload, providing practical and commercially focused advice.

How to prepare for a job interview at LJ Recruitment Limited

Know Your Case Law

Brush up on relevant case law and recent legal developments in litigation. Being able to discuss these confidently will show your expertise and passion for the field.

Demonstrate Your Problem-Solving Skills

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ed contentious matters in the past. Highlight your approach to problem-solving and how you can apply it to the firm's cases.

Understand the Firm's Culture

Research the firm’s values and culture. Tailor your responses to reflect how you align with their ethos, showing that you're not just a fit for the role but also for the team.

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the firm’s current cases or future direction. This demonstrates your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
